Garlic is one of the most popular and versatile ingredients in the world. It is used in cuisines around the globe, adding its unique flavor and aroma to dishes of all kinds. But garlic is more than just a delicious condiment. It also has a long history of use as a medicinal plant.

The active compound in garlic is allicin, which is formed when garlic is crushed or chopped. Allicin has a wide range of antimicrobial and antioxidant properties. It has been shown to be effective against bacteria, viruses, and fungi. Garlic has also been shown to boost the immune system, lower cholesterol levels, and reduce the risk of heart disease and cancer.

How to include more garlic in your diet:

Garlic is easy to add to your diet. It can be used fresh, dried, or powdered. Garlic can be added to soups, stews, sauces, and stir-fries. It can also be used to marinate meats or tofu.

Here are a few tips for adding more garlic to your diet:

  • Start your day with a garlic clove: Crush a garlic clove and add it to a glass of water or juice. Drink this first thing in the morning to boost your immune system and start your day off right.
  • Add garlic to your favorite recipes: Garlic can be added to almost any recipe. Try adding a few cloves of garlic to your next batch of soup, stew, or pasta sauce. You can also use garlic to marinate meats or tofu before grilling or baking.
  • Make garlic dressing: Garlic dressing is a delicious and healthy way to add garlic to your diet. Simply combine minced garlic, olive oil, balsamic vinegar, and Dijon mustard in a blender or food processor. Blend until smooth and season with salt and pepper to taste.
  • Grow your own garlic: Growing your own garlic is easy and rewarding. Garlic cloves can be planted in the fall and will be ready to harvest in the summer.
